Troubleshooting Common Issues with the NovaStar LED Controller
When dealing with issues with your NovaStar LED controller, it's essential to perform systematic troubleshooting steps. Begin by confirming the power supply connection and ensuring the controller is properly connected to your panel. Analyze the LED display for any observable indicators of a problem, such as flickering or faulty colors.
Next, review the NovaStar controller's manual for specific troubleshooting tips related to your version. Leverage any built-in test features within the controller's software interface to identify potential issues. If you remain to encounter problems, contact NovaStar's technical support for further help.
- Verify the software version of your controller and ensure it is up to date.
- Scrutinize the connection cables for any faults.
- Evaluate different signal sources to rule out problems on your end.
